Cabin Fever makes a welcome return to those old 70's and 80's horror films with heaps of gore, violence and nudity.

However Cabin Fever give a new spin on that. Instead of the boring masked killer stalking these kids holidaying in a log cabin, its an inescapable virus in the water supply...

Director Eli Roth does great things with his cast. Who'd have thunk the perky breasted Foreign Exchange student from Not Another Teen Movie could actually act!?

As for the strange ending involving an apparently racist shop keeper and three black teens walking towards his establishment, blame his friendship with David Lynch... Never before have i laughed so hard over a pointless joke in a film before.

Things are looking up for horror. With this, Texas Chainsaw Massacre not sucking and 28 Days Later, we have been spoiled. Here's hoping that Wes Craven's Cursed doesn't suck...
